More about the restaurant: Agenda 87
Despite any suggestions from the name, Agenda 87 should certainly be at the very top of your agenda if you’re around Shawlands in Glasgow. It’s a restaurant and bar with a whole load of style and you’ll be taken aback by the cool glass exterior that brings calm and composure to the bustle of Kilmarnock Road. Inside, it’s much the same story, with contemporary decor that complements a fusion menu of International cuisines. This is a beautiful spot for casual dining with hint of a luxury, and the fullness of the bar and knowledge of the staff only adds to this unique Glasgow dining experience.

Leading into the very heart of Glasgow, Kilmarnock Road is busy and packed full of places to drink and dine. None, however, are quite like Agenda 87. Why? Because at Agenda 87 there’s style and there’s substance – a combination that’s often hard to come by in Shawlands. We’ll start with the decor. Expect exposed brick walls and original iron beams, as well as sophisticated green leather and low lighting. Agenda 87 feels like a VIP experience, regardless of when you’re stopping by. The well-stock bar takes centre stage, with well-spaced seating surrounding it. Agenda 87 offers a stunning environment to enjoy a menu that fuses the best flavours from all around the world.
The pizzas are the big hitters on the Italian side of the menu as all doughs are made with a special blend of imported flours and allowed to rise for at least 48 hours. The monza is one not to miss, topped with chicken breast, Italian sausage and pepperoni, but if meat isn’t your thing then Greco, with mozzarella, red peppers, olives, rocket and feta is refreshing and light. This Glasgow hotspot also serves gourmet burgers and foot-long hot dogs, while some additional favourites include grilled sea bass, Thai green curry and the classic fish and chips, in this case beer battered haddock.
